- [ ] **Off-site run: stage props for the Lanternvale Revue tour**
  Load the three flight cases (marked "Revue A–C") plus the soft bag with the banners. Props master at the Corbin Hall stage door signs for everything — nobody else. Keep the cases upright; the mirror piece is fragile. The courier hand-over note below is confidential, so share it with the driver in person only.

handover note for yagef-bagep: the drudor pelius courier leaves the kasdor zorvan norir ledger at gate 8016 under passcode 755406

This service ingests RFID pings from the timing mats used at the Corvane Bay Marathon and forwards split times to the results backend. Each mat reports over a serial-to-TCP bridge; the reader deduplicates multiple pings from the same chip within a two-second window and stamps everything against a single monotonic clock. For review purposes, note that the dedupe window and clock source are both configurable, and race-day values differ from the defaults used in testing. The production deployment uses the configuration below.

settings of fafog-haduf:
ZORIX_PIN=4648
ZORIX_METRICS_HOST=metrics.zorix.paliqsys.corp
ZORIX_LOG_LEVEL=info
ZORIX_TENANT=druix

MINUTES — Management Meeting, Ostrey Works

Attendees: Falk, Merion, Dutta. For incoming director.

1. Warranty costs on the Corvax R2 pump exceeded plan by 34%. Root cause: seal supplier change in March.
2. Merion to negotiate recovery from Tallin Fabrication; target 50% cost share.
3. Field repair backlog at the Brenholt depot to clear within six weeks.
4. Reserve topped up; margin guidance unchanged externally.

Actions logged. Next review in four weeks. Context for these decisions follows directly below.

board note of fahag-tajop: The eastern region missed its Julix quota by 44.0 percent last quarter. Ralionax Holdings plans to lower the Druath list price by 61.8 percent in March. The board signed off on a budget of $295.0 million for Project Gilath. The renewal with Ruswynix Systems closes at $274.5 million a year, 17.0 percent above the last contract.